About General Salgado
Situated in Brazil's São Paulo region, General Salgado is a town that forms an important part of the local area. The city's population stands at approximately 10,312, reflecting its role as an important local centre.
The city's coordinates — 20.65°S, 50.36°W — place it in the Southern Western Hemisphere. All local activities follow the America/Sao_Paulo timezone. Being in the Southern Hemisphere, this city's warmest months fall between December and February.
